In the current Ubuntu Bionic Salt Version 2017.7.4
"mysql_grants.present" state crashes with a TypeError traceback. This
issue was accepted and fixed by upstream for the next version
(2018.3.4):
Issue: https://github.com/saltstack/salt/issues/45026
Merge Request: https://github.com/saltstack/salt/pull/50823/files
Commit:
https://github.com/saltstack/salt/commit/ec8e116f7e368a28790fc20dfe03eda7fc28e4e6
Unfortunaltely, the fix is based on the helper function
salt.utils.data.decode() which is not available in Bionic's version.
There is another fix for this issue, which will make the state usable,
which was suggested by one GitHub user:
https://github.com/saltstack/salt/issues/45026#issuecomment-439083704
Can Bionic's Salt Version get patched, so that the
"mysql_grants.present" state is useable?
